| 27-6-2009 - My breastfeeding Plan for Tyler this year | My mood while writing this blog:productive |
Sometime between mid July and the end of July I will have to return to work and I don't want to stop breastfeeding my baby but I wont be able to pump while on the road for three reasons:
#1. My car gets severely hot in the summer and melts ice packs in coolers.. How I know? B/c I have to draw blood on pts and keep it on ice in coolers in my car and have to rush to Labcorp before the Ice packs melt! and my car is new and has good AC it's just that hot here in Texas.
#2. There are few places I can pump although I am not afraid to pump in my car there are bad neigblorhoods that I have to see pts and don't want to stop my car in for that long.
#3. Worry about contaminating the milk or supplies after being in some of the dirty houses, even though I wash my hands and use alcohol sanitizer I still worry about that.
But I think I found a solution... cut and plasted from website... http://gotmom.org/lifestyle.cfm
"Your body will respond to changes in demand, so you will need to pump when you are away from the baby if you want to keep up your supply. Some mothers find that it works best for them, after their milk supply is well-established, to nurse mornings, evenings and during the night, and to feed with breast milk substitutes during the day. Believe it or not, your body will respond to this schedule, producing very little milk during the day and just what your baby needs when you are home. It's OK to alternate breast milk with formula; combination feedings generally won't upset the baby. Remember, there is no one right way to do this - with help, every mother and baby can work out what is right for them."
Does anyone know who only fed in the morning, evening and night, and didn't get engorged the 8 hrs during the day??? Would be awesome if I could make this work out!!!!
